Cheyenne vs Bermudan Seniors Poverty Over the Age of 65 Correlation Chart
The stat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 80,672,543 people shows a poor positive correlation between the proportion of Cheyenne and poverty level among seniors over the age of 65 in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.169 and weighted average of 13.9%. Similarly, the stat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 55,699,016 people shows a weak negative correlation between the proportion of Bermudans and poverty level among seniors over the age of 65 in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of -0.220 and weighted average of 11.9%, a difference of 16.9%.
